Presentation, discussion, and possible action regarding status of 100-acre-foot <br />detention pond project near the Pasadena Convention Center and Brookglen <br />Subdivision, as established in amended interlocal agreement between the City of <br />La Porte and the City of Pasadena. [Lorenzo Wingate, Assistant Director of Public <br />Works] <br />Mr. Wingate said the City had not heard of anything from the U.S. Army Corps of <br />Engineers, as of today. He confirmed the City had placed security cameras in Brookglen <br />due to reports of illegal dumping. <br />e. Presentation, discussion, and possible action regarding the Harris County Flood <br />Control District's (HCFCD) and Harris County Precinct 2's current and future plans <br />related to flooding in the City of La Porte. [Lorenzo Wingate, Assistant Director of <br />Public Works] <br />Mr. Wingate discussed the lower pond level and unsightliness at Wood Falls Park due to <br />the slough being de -silted. Mr. Alexander said the Parks and Recreation Department was <br />addressing the issue. <br />f. Presentation, discussion, and possible action regarding the status of current <br />drainage projects. [Lorenzo Wingate, Assistant Director of Public Works] <br />Mr. Wingate said the PER for the Brookglen analysis was being reviewed and that Bayside <br />Terrace bids were being evaluated. <br />g. Presentation, discussion, and possible action to provide administrative staff of the <br />City with direction, if necessary, regarding additional drainage concerns. [Lorenzo <br />Wingate, Assistant Director of Public Works] <br />Mr. Wingate was asked to keep a focus on the bar ditches on the east side of Broadway <br />which are maintained by TxDOT, with reference to concerns of Chair Martin. Mr. Wingate <br />agreed to visit the Lomax area to investigate items that Member Williams and City <br />Manager Alexander have been working on. <br />4. SET NEXT MEETING <br />The next meeting was set for June 12, 2023. <br />5.
